NL Miles Coaching & Consulting offers private mediation services to help families navigate the difficult transitions that come with divorce, separation, paternity disputes, and co-parenting challenges. Mediation is a confidential and cost-effective alternative to litigation that empowers both parties to create their own agreement in a respectful and solution-focused environment.

How It Works
-
Step 1: Schedule a Free Consultation
Let’s determine if mediation is the right fit for your situation. We’ll review your case type and answer any questions you have. -
Step 2: Mediation Sessions
Sessions take place virtually or in-person (based on availability), and generally last 1–2 hours. Most cases require 1–3 sessions. -
Step 3: Final Agreement
Once both parties reach consensus, a written agreement can be drafted and signed. You may submit this to the court, or review it with an attorney.
